    Rob Roy movie sporran...

    Has anyone ever seen (or made, for that matter) a faithful replica of the sporran worn by Lian Neeson in the film Rob Roy?

    I know that there are a thousand "Rob Roy style" sporrans out there, made with a drawstring bag, a flap, and a belt loop. What I'm enquiring after is one that replicates the unique look of the sporran from the film.

    Ehem... Now then- It looks so far like no one has yet been able to figure out how to make a sporran that really looks like the one in the film.

    I'll admit, I've tried to figure it out, but I'm still unsure as to exactly how the bag is made. In fact, if you look closely enough, it almost seems that he's not always wearing exactly the same sporran. It looks notably different, in various ways, throughout the film. I, and others(see above), am wondering if the costume people for the film had more than one sporran for Neeson's wardrobe, and that the two or more sporrans were not all constructed exactly the same way.
